🎙 In this episode, I share how Claude has fundamentally changed the way I create and ship courses by turning a tangled mess of tools into a fully automated, end-to-end production line. I walk you through the stack of “skills” I’ve trained Claude to perform so far, including scraping all my course transcripts, generating logos, slides, handouts, and lock pages. As well as feeding everything into Circle and Descript. With all that in place, I have been able to create and deploy a brand-new course in under a week.

You’ll hear how this compound automation approach is letting me build an AI-powered brain for my business that is dramatically increasing how fast I am able to turn ideas into live, revenue-generating business resources and services.

KEY TAKEAWAYS

💡 Turn Claude into Your Execution Engine: Don’t just ask Claude questions; give it skills it can use repeatedly. Train it to do repeatable tasks, e.g. scraping, formatting, summarising, drafting, posting, and it will quietly run big chunks of your business while you stay focused on thinking and leading.

💡 Stack Small Skills Into Automated End‑to‑End Systems: The magic isn’t one clever prompt; it’s chaining lots of tiny Claude skills together so an entire workflow - content, ops, client delivery, sales and follow‑up can run from a single instruction.

💡 Feed Claude With Your Real Business Data and Processes: When you give Claude your transcripts, calls, documents, and templates, it stops being a generic chatbot and becomes a bespoke operator that understands how your business really runs.

💡 Let Claude Handle the “Faff,” Keep Humans for the Final 5%: Use Claude to do the clicking, copying, pasting, tagging, and drafting across your tools, then use your team to check the result and sign off before deployment.

ABOUT THE HOSTSteve moved to Sweden in 2015 and transformed how he ran his businesses—switching to a fully remote model. A former NHS doctor, with a background in computing and property investing, he now helps overwhelmed business owners systemise and outsource effectively. Through his courses and coaching, Steve teaches how to automate operations and work with affordable virtual assistants, freeing up time and increasing profits. He runs his UK-based businesses remotely with support from a team of UK and Filipino VAs, and is passionate about helping others build scalable, stress-free companies using smart systems and virtual support.
